Deposits In Transit
Funds that have been received and recorded by a business but not yet by its bank, typically relating to bank reconciliation processes.
Purchase Order
A formal document sent from a buyer to a seller to initiate the purchase of products or services with specified terms.
Vendor
An individual or company that sells goods or services to another entity, typically within a supply chain.
Petty Cash
A small amount of cash kept on hand for making immediate payments for miscellaneous small expenses in an office or business.
